Katerina Nazarova (née Mitchell)

Violin

MUSICAL EDUCATION

  • Artist Diploma, Royal College of Music (2010)
  • Master of Music in Advanced Performance graduating with Distinction, Royal College of Music (2009)
  • Bachelor of Music with First Class Honours, Royal College of Music (2007)

ORCHESTRAL EXPERIENCE/FREELANCE

  • Trial for Leader of BBC Concert Orchestra (2016)
  • Trial for Sub-Leader (no.3) Bournemouth Symphony Orchestra (2016)
  • Trial for Leader of Scottish Chamber Orchestra (2015)
  • Trial for Assistant Leader (no.3) City of Birmingham Symphony Orchestra (2015)
  • Trial for Section Leader (Principal) 2nd Violin City of Birmingham Symphony Orchestra (2015)
  • Trial for Principal Second Violin of the BBC Symphony Orchestra (2013)
  • Guest Concertmaster with the Melbourne Symphony Orchestra
  • John Wilson Orchestra – Principal 2nd Violins
  • English Chamber Orchestra - No.2 2nd Violins, Principal 2nd Violin and No.3 1st Violin
  • Academy of St. Martin’s in the Field
  • Royal Northern Sinfonia
  • London Symphony Orchestra
  • London Philharmonic Orchestra
  • Philharmonia Orchestra
  • Royal Philharmonic Orchestra
  • Royal Philharmonic Concert Orchestra
  • Sessions – English Session Orchestra; CoolMusic; films including
    Harry Potter, Rise of the Guardians, Anna Karenina, The Ides of March;

SOLO AND CHAMBER MUSIC

  • Performing with Trio Bresciani at the Seoul Arts Centre, South Korea (October 2016)
  • A PROJECT Chamber Music Festival, Spain (2016)
  • Bruch G minor Concerto with the Melbourne Symphony Orchestra (2014)
  • Bruch G minor Concerto and Waxman Carmen Fantasy with the Tasmanian Symphony Orchestra (2014)
  • Brahms Concerto with the Sydney Symphony Orchestra (2013)
  • Sangat Chamber Music Festival, Mumbai (2013)
  • Shostakovich 1st Concerto with the Western Australia Symphony Orchestra and Adelaide Symphony Orchestra (2012)
  • Stravinsky’s L’Histoire du Soldat in the Elgar Room, Royal Albert Hall
  • Sibelius Violin Concerto with the Royal College of Music Sinfonietta
  • Ravel Septet in Cadogan Hall
  • Directed Mozart Violin Concerto No.5 from the violin, London

AWARDS/SCHOLARSHIPS

  • Prize winner in the 2015 Royal Overseas League Competition
  • Sibelius Violin Competition (2015)
  • Grand Prize at the ABC Symphony Australia Young Performers Awards (2012)
  • Prize winner at the Postacchini International Violin Competition (2010)
  • Leverhulme Scholar at the Royal College of Music (2007 – 2010)
  • Scholarship holder from Youth Music Foundation Australia (2005 – 2010)
  • Scholarship holder from the Tait Memorial Trust (2005 - 2007)
